Witryna1 gru 2024 · Congress passed the Paycheck Protection Program (PPP) loan as part of the Coronavirus Aid, Relief and Economic Security (CARES) Act to provide fast and direct economic assistance for small businesses and to preserve jobs for Americans. This loan has allowed many small businesses to stay afloat during the sudden economic … Witryna10 kwi 2024 · The Paycheck Protection Program (PPP) and the PPP Liquidity Facility were launched early in the pandemic to help many small businesses survive.
